Output e8406590eca24d99a4286aed60feebd9817f313328780c3c60f80075bcb0be58:0

value
5889163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a16bfa52f6937f91509abd6afcb86b9b6dd514ea OP_EQUAL
address
3GQY4robhRQghufLixHNRD58GLa6EEJW48
transaction
e8406590eca24d99a4286aed60feebd9817f313328780c3c60f80075bcb0be58
spent
true